What is Microsoft Dynamics 365 for Customer Service?
Microsoft Dynamics 365 for Customer Service is a cloud-based customer relationship management (CRM) solution that empowers businesses to streamline customer interactions, enhance service delivery, and build lasting customer relationships. It offers a comprehensive suite of tools to manage customer support across all channels, including phone, email, chat, social media, and self-service portals.

Core Functionalities of Microsoft Dynamics 365 for Customer Service
Microsoft Dynamics 365 for Customer Service encompasses a wide range of functionalities that cater to various aspects of customer support:
- Case Management: Manage customer interactions effectively by tracking cases, assigning them to the appropriate agents, and monitoring their progress to resolution.
- Knowledge Base: Create a centralized repository of self-service knowledge articles, FAQs, and solutions to empower customers to resolve issues independently.
- Customer Service Portal: Provide customers with a self-service portal to access account information, submit support requests, track case progress, and manage their subscriptions.
- Social Media Monitoring: Monitor social media conversations to identify customer concerns, respond promptly, and proactively address negative feedback.
- Customer Analytics: Gain insights into customer behavior, preferences, and feedback to improve customer service and satisfaction.

Case Management:
Case management is a core function of Microsoft Dynamics 365 for Customer Service, enabling businesses to effectively track, prioritize, and resolve customer issues. The solution provides a centralized platform for managing cases across all channels, including phone, email, chat, and social media.
Key features of case management include:
- Case creation and tracking: Create and track customer cases, capturing details such as issue description, customer information, and priority level.
- Case assignment and routing: Assign cases to the appropriate agents based on their skills, availability, and workload.
- Case escalation: Escalate cases to higher-level support personnel when necessary to ensure timely resolution.
Knowledge Base:
A well-crafted knowledge base is essential for empowering customers to resolve issues independently. Microsoft Dynamics 365 for Customer Service provides a robust knowledge base management tool to create, organize, and maintain a comprehensive repository of self-service resources.
Key features of knowledge base management include:
- Article creation and editing: Create and edit knowledge articles, providing detailed solutions to common customer issues.
- Article organization and categorization: Organize articles into categories and subcategories for easy navigation.
- Article search and filtering: Enable customers to easily search for relevant articles using keywords and filters.
- Article feedback and evaluation: Collect feedback from customers to improve the quality and relevance of knowledge articles.
